Music, News, Travel Bought Tickets to See Our Last Night + Jule Vera Live in Atlanta 7th February 20188th June 2018by Alexis Chateau9 Comments on Bought Tickets to See Our Last Night + Jule Vera Live in Atlanta I can't wait!